WWW DownloadManager, C#
Hi, i'm implementing something like download manager to unity using WWW class. I want to download and use things in order, as they came to me. Here's my code:
using UnityEngine;
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Collections;
public class DownloadManager : MonoBehaviour
{
private class Downloadable
{
public string url { get; set; }
public DownloadCallback fn { get; set; }
public Downloadable (string url, DownloadCallback fn)
{
this.url = url;
this.fn = fn;
}
}
private WWW wwwData;
public delegate void DownloadCallback (WWW wwwData);
private static DownloadManager dm = null;
private static Queue<Downloadable> queue;
// Use this for initialization
void Start ()
{
if (DownloadManager.dm == null) {
DownloadManager.dm = FindObjectOfType (typeof(DownloadManager)) as DownloadManager;
}
queue = new Queue<Downloadable> ();
}
void FixedUpdate ()
{
if (queue.Count == 0 || (wwwData != null && wwwData.isDone == false)) {
return;
}
Downloadable first = queue.Dequeue ();
StartDownload (first.url, first.fn);
}
void OnApplicationQuit ()
{
DownloadManager.dm = null;
}
private IEnumerator WaitForDownload (DownloadCallback fn)
{
yield return wwwData;
fn (wwwData);
}
private void StartDownload (string sURL, DownloadCallback fn)
{
try {
Debug.Log ("start download: " + sURL);
wwwData = new WWW (sURL);
StartCoroutine ("WaitForDownload", fn);
} catch (Exception e) {
Debug.Log (e.ToString ());
}
}
public static void Download (string sURL, DownloadCallback fn)
{
Debug.Log ("added to queue: " + sURL);
queue.Enqueue (new Downloadable (sURL, fn));
}
}
But StartCoroutine ("WaitForDownload", fn); in StartDownload function starts not when previous thing finishes downloads,but immediately. How to fix that problem?

It seems that I found solution. I used StartCoroutine function not in good way. Here's right version:
using UnityEngine;
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Collections;
public class DownloadManager : MonoBehaviour
{
private class Downloadable
{
public string url { get; set; }
public DownloadCallback fn { get; set; }
public Downloadable (string url, DownloadCallback fn)
{
this.url = url;
this.fn = fn;
}
}
private WWW wwwData;
public delegate void DownloadCallback (WWW wwwData);
private static DownloadManager instance = null;
private static Queue<Downloadable> queue;
// Use this for initialization
void Start ()
{
if (DownloadManager.instance == null) {
DownloadManager.instance = FindObjectOfType (typeof(DownloadManager)) as DownloadManager;
}
queue = new Queue<Downloadable> ();
}
void FixedUpdate ()
{
if (queue.Count == 0 || (wwwData != null && wwwData.isDone == false)) {
return;
}
StartCoroutine ("StartDownload");
//StartDownload();
}
void OnApplicationQuit ()
{
DownloadManager.instance = null;
}
private IEnumerator OnDownload(Downloadable toDownload) {
wwwData = new WWW (toDownload.url);
yield return wwwData;
}
private IEnumerator StartDownload ()
{
Downloadable toDownload = queue.Dequeue();
yield return StartCoroutine("OnDownload", toDownload);
Debug.Log("downloaded: " + toDownload.url);
toDownload.fn (wwwData);
}
public static void Download (string sURL, DownloadCallback fn)
{
queue.Enqueue (new Downloadable (sURL, fn));
}
}
